Output 40649eef3db2fc0336172cbc5d6d7efbda1e29c6fbcac61a7771fe5fe0811014:121

value
527034
script pubkey
OP_0 OP_PUSHBYTES_20 e2df36403943c0535a25ddb0a89c752f35661309
address
bc1qut0nvspeg0q9xk39mkc238r49u6kvycftwsfwl
transaction
40649eef3db2fc0336172cbc5d6d7efbda1e29c6fbcac61a7771fe5fe0811014
spent
true